Transponder news 22.04.2008

By swen002 - 22.04.2008

image
Intelsat 904, 60.0°E
'SGU TV' has started on 11675V (Moscow beam), DVB-S2/8PSK/MPEG-4/clear, SR 29700, FEC 2/3. (Moshe, 21:32 CET)
Intelsat 12, 45.0°E
'Bridge TV' has started testing on 11550V (Europe beam), MPEG-4/clear, SR 27500, FEC 7/8. (M.Glagazin, 21:45 CET)
'Bridge TV', 'Israel Plus International', 'Mezzo', 'Ocean TV' and 'Zee TV Russia' are now in clear on 11550V (Europe beam), SR 27500, FEC 7/8. (M.Glagazin, 21:42 CET)
Eutelsat W2, 16.0°E
'Discovery Channel Europe', 'Discovery Science', 'Discovery World', 'Nat Geo Wild', 'National Geographic Channel Europe', 'The History Channel UK', 'TVA' and 'VH1 Europe A' are now encrypted in Conax on 11094V (Europe beam), MPEG-4/Conax, SR 27900, FEC 2/3. (KingOfSat, 19:55 CET)
Hot Bird 6, 13.0°E
'Raitalia 3 Europe' has left 10992V. (KingOfSat, 20:42 CET)
Eurobird 9, 9.0°E
'Duna TV' has left 12073V. (Webmaster, 21:25 CET)
'Hír TV' has started on 12034V (Europe beam), DVB-S2/8PSK/MPEG-2/clear, SR 27500, FEC 2/3. (Webmaster, 21:14 CET)
Sirius 4, 4.8°E
The 'Viasat Ukraine' mux with '1+1', 'Cartoon Network Russia', 'Detskij Telekanal', 'Discovery Channel Central & Eastern Europe', 'Discovery Science', 'Discovery World', 'Drive', 'Extreme Sports Channel', 'Hallmark Channel Russia & Middle East', 'ICTV', 'KidsCo', 'National Geographic Channel Russia', 'Nickelodeon CIS', 'Novy Kanal', 'Ohota i Rybalka', 'Russkij Illusion', 'Spice', 'STB', 'TCM Europe', 'TRK Ukraïna', 'TV 1000 Russkoe Kino', 'VH1 Europe A', 'Viasat Explorer', 'Viasat History' and 'Zone Club Europe' has started regular broadcasting on 12169V (Europe BSS beam), DVB-S2/8PSK/MPEG-4/Videoguard, SR 27500, FEC 3/4. (Webmaster, 19:25 CET)
The 'Viasat Ukraine' mux with '24 Techno', 'AXN Sci-Fi Russia', 'CNN International Europe', 'Feniks-Art', 'Fox Crime Russia', 'Fox Life Russia', 'Jetix Central & Eastern Europe', 'NSTV (Nastoyashchee strashnoe televideniye)', 'The Adult Channel', 'The MGM Channel East Europe', 'TV 1000 East', 'TV XXI' and 'Zone Reality EMEA' has started regular broadcasting on 12207V (Europe BSS beam), DVB-S2/8PSK/MPEG-4/Videoguard, SR 27500, FEC 3/4. (Webmaster, 19:23 CET)
